    Understanding the Core of the Israel-Iran Conflict

    Firstly, let's understand the core of the Israel-Iran conflict. This is not a new story; the tensions have been simmering for decades. It's crucial to grasp the fundamental issues to understand today's headlines. The main factors driving this conflict are a mix of ideological differences, geopolitical power struggles, and proxy wars. Iran, a Shia theocracy, fundamentally opposes Israel's existence, viewing it as an illegitimate state. This ideological clash is a primary driver of the animosity. Iran backs numerous militant groups in the region, such as Hezbollah in Lebanon and Hamas in Gaza, that are sworn to Israel's destruction. These proxies are a significant source of tension, constantly engaging in conflicts and skirmishes with Israel. Israel, on the other hand, sees Iran's nuclear program as a major threat. Although Iran insists its nuclear program is for peaceful purposes, Israel believes it is designed to create nuclear weapons. This perception fuels Israel's determination to prevent Iran from obtaining such weapons. Furthermore, the two countries are vying for regional dominance. Iran seeks to expand its influence throughout the Middle East, while Israel aims to maintain its strategic advantage and protect its borders. The competition for power exacerbates the existing tensions, making the situation even more volatile. The current conflict is a complex situation. Israel sees Iran’s nuclear program as an existential threat and has taken action to thwart it. The activities have included cyberattacks, assassinations of scientists, and military strikes on Iranian assets. It's a delicate balance of power, where each move is carefully considered and the consequences are always high.

    The Role of Proxies in the Conflict

    It’s impossible to talk about the Israel-Iran conflict without mentioning proxies. Iran has used these groups as tools to project power and wage a shadow war against Israel. Hezbollah, the Lebanese militant group, is a significant player, often clashing with Israel across the border. Hamas, which controls the Gaza Strip, frequently fires rockets into Israel, leading to retaliatory strikes. These groups are heavily funded, trained, and armed by Iran, serving as a critical component of Iran's strategy. They act as a constant source of pressure on Israel, creating a low-intensity conflict that can escalate at any moment. The existence of these proxies allows Iran to exert influence without directly engaging in a full-scale war, but it also creates instability. Any miscalculation or escalation by these groups can easily trigger a larger conflict. For Israel, dealing with these proxies is a constant challenge. Israel must balance its need to protect its citizens with the risk of sparking a wider war. The strategies employed include intelligence gathering, preemptive strikes, and targeted assassinations of key figures. The role of proxies has further complicated the conflict, making it more unpredictable and dangerous. Understanding the role of these proxies is vital for grasping the dynamics of the ongoing conflict. Their actions are not isolated events but rather part of a broader, carefully orchestrated strategy by Iran to undermine Israel and advance its regional interests.     The Impact of Geopolitical Events

    Geopolitical events have a big impact on the Israel-Iran conflict. Things happening around the world influence the dynamics between the two countries. The positions of major global powers, like the United States, Russia, and China, significantly influence the situation. The U.S. has historically been a strong ally of Israel, providing military and diplomatic support. Any shifts in U.S. policy or leadership can significantly impact the region. Russia and China also have a role to play. They may have their own interests and alliances in the Middle East. They may influence the balance of power. The actions of regional actors, such as Saudi Arabia, the United Arab Emirates, and other Arab nations, can also have a significant impact. They have complex relationships with both Israel and Iran, creating a web of alliances and rivalries. International agreements and treaties, such as the Iran nuclear deal, play a significant role. These agreements can influence the level of sanctions imposed on Iran. They also affect the country's access to resources and its ability to pursue its nuclear program. The actions of international organizations, such as the United Nations, are essential. They provide platforms for dialogue, mediation, and conflict resolution. However, they sometimes struggle to achieve consensus and take effective action. In short, the geopolitical landscape is complex. It involves numerous actors and factors. Any significant change in one area can easily trigger a chain reaction, which can affect the relationship between Israel and Iran. This is why keeping an eye on the bigger picture is so important.

    Potential Flashpoints and Risks

    Let’s discuss some potential flashpoints and risks associated with the Israel-Iran conflict. These are areas where tensions are high and where the risk of escalation is especially significant. One of the most dangerous flashpoints is the ongoing proxy conflicts. Any significant escalation in the fighting between Israel and Hezbollah or Hamas could quickly spiral out of control. Another significant risk is related to Iran's nuclear program. Any action that is seen as a violation of the existing agreements or a significant advancement toward nuclear weapons could lead to a military strike by Israel. The cyber warfare between Israel and Iran also poses a significant risk. Cyberattacks can target critical infrastructure. They can disrupt essential services. They can even create a situation where a military conflict could be escalated unintentionally. There is a risk of miscalculation. Both sides may misread each other’s intentions or underestimate the other’s response. A small event can trigger a larger crisis. Diplomatic failures, such as a breakdown in negotiations or a lack of communication, can increase the risk of conflict. Effective diplomacy can help prevent misunderstandings and defuse tensions.
